Front Door With Window: A Comprehensive Guide
When it concerns improving the curb appeal and functionality of a home, the option of a front door significantly affects the total aesthetic. One popular option that house owners typically consider is the front door with a window. This article supplies an extensive expedition of front doors including windows, detailing their advantages, design alternatives, materials, and considerations for installation.
Understanding Front Doors with Windows
Front doors with windows can be found in numerous designs and materials, offering an exceptional combination of visual appeals and practicality. These doors generally include glass panels that can be developed in different sizes, shapes, and designs, enabling natural light to illuminate the entryway while offering a clear view of the outside.
Advantages of Front Doors with Windows
Picking a front door with a window offers a number of advantages:
- Natural Light: The primary advantage is the influx of natural light. This can make the entrance intense and welcoming.
- Exposure: Windows in front doors frequently provide exposure to the outside world, boosting awareness of visitors before opening the door.
- Aesthetic Appeal: A front door with a window can act as a declaration piece, add character to your home, and enhance the total architectural design.
- Airflow: Some designs permit ventilation, enhancing airflow in the entranceway.
- Security Features: Modern front doors with windows typically include tempered glass or other security functions to hinder burglaries.

Products Used in Front Doors with Windows
When thinking about a front door with a window, the material is important for durability, insulation, and maintenance. Here are some typically used products:
1. Fiberglass
- Extremely suggested due to energy effectiveness.
- Resistant to warping and can simulate the appearance of wood.
- Low upkeep requirements.
2. Wood
- Deals classic appeal and heat.
- Requires routine upkeep (staining or painting) to avoid weather condition damage.
- Various kinds of wood can offer unique aesthetic appeals.
3. Steel
- Provides high security and durability.
- More resistant to impact than wood or fiberglass.
- Minimal design versatility however can be customized.
4. Vinyl
- Economical and energy-efficient.
- Low maintenance and offered in numerous styles.
- Typically, not as aesthetically appealing as wood or fiberglass.
Table: Comparison of Front Door Materials
Material | Toughness | Maintenance | Cost | Insulation Efficiency | Visual Appeal |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
Fiberglass | High | Low | Moderate | Outstanding | Versatile |
Wood | Moderate | High | High | Moderate | High |
Steel | High | Low | Moderate | Moderate | Moderate |
Vinyl | Moderate | Low | Low | Excellent | Moderate |
Installation Considerations
When setting up a front door with a window, several factors need to be considered:
- Professional vs. DIY: While some homeowners might opt for a DIY setup, hiring a professional makes sure that the door is correctly fitted and company sealed, preventing drafts or leaks.
- Regulative Guidelines: Compliance with local structure codes regarding glass installation is crucial for safety.
- Weather Stripping: Ensure proper weather stripping is utilized around the door to enhance energy efficiency.
- Security Measures: Choose doors with safe locks and think about strengthening windows with laminated glass or decorative grilles.
- Maintenance Plan: Depending on the material picked, a maintenance plan ought to be developed to maintain the door's condition and appearance.
FAQs
1. Are front doors with windows more pricey than strong doors?
- Usually, front doors with windows can be more expensive due to the additional materials and style complexity. However, expense varies extensively based on the product and producer.
2. How do I clean up the glass on my front door?
- Use a soft cloth and a quality glass cleaner. Avoid abrasive materials that may scratch the glass surface area.
3. Can I change a solid door with a door that has windows?
- Yes, replacing a strong door with a front door with windows is possible, however structural modifications may be required.
4. Do front doors with windows offer adequate security?
- Modern doors with windows are designed with safety in mind. Search for tempered glass options and robust locking mechanisms to boost security.
